Thomas Jefferson National Accelerator Facility (Jefferson Lab) provides scientists worldwide the lab’s unique particle accelerator, known as the Continuous Electron Beam Accelerator Facility (CEBAF), to probe the most basic building blocks of matter by conducting research at the frontiers of nuclear physics (NP) and related disciplines.
In addition, the lab capitalizes on its unique technologies and expertise to perform advanced computing and applied research with industry and university partners, and provides programs designed to help educate the next generation in science and technology. A Dan Janzen arranged, USAID sponsored meeting at ERIN (Environmental Resources Information Network) to examine Biodiversity Data Management, GIS, etc, in March 1993.
This meeting, is thought by some to be the beginning of Biodiversity Informatics as a discipline.
Those present in the image include: Laurie Dorr (Smithsonian), Leon Bennun (Kenya), Arie Budeman (Indonesia), Christine McMahon (Missouri), Dan Janzen (Philadelphia), Winnie Hallwachs (Philadelphia), Lenn Nunn (BMNH), Jorge Jiminez (INBIO, Costa Rica), John Burley (Harvard), Stan Blum (Smithsonian), Scott Miller (Hawaii)

On Wednesday, 2 March 2022, the first stone-laying ceremony for the Cherenkov Telescope Array Observatory (CTAO) Science Data Management Centre (SDMC) took place at the Deutsches Elektronen-Synchrotron (DESY) campus in Zeuthen, Brandenburg (Germany). To celebrate this milestone, Brandenburg’s Science Minister, Manja Schüle, and Head of the Sub-Department Large-Scale Facilities and Basic Research at the Federal Ministry of Education and Research, Volkmar Dietz, participated in the ceremony on campus, together with the Managing Director of the CTAO gGmbH, Federico Ferrini and the Chairman of the DESY Board of Directors, Helmut Dosch.

David West
Senior Vice President of Marketing and Business Development
CommVault
David West has served as CommVault's senior vice president of marketing and business development since April 2011. Prior to his current role, he served as vice president of marketing and business development from September 2005 to March 2011, and as vice president of business development from August 2000 to September 2005.
Prior to joining CommVault, West served as a director of strategic alliances from April 1999 to July 2000 and vice president of storage solutions in July 2000 at Legato Systems, Inc., which was subsequently acquired by EMC Corporation. Prior to joining Legato Systems, he served as vice president of sales at Intelliguard Software, Inc., which was also subsequently acquired by EMC Corporation.
West obtained his bachelor's degree in electrical engineering from Villanova University.
